如何利用Java和Eclipse开发一款融合藏族文化的打骰子电子游戏?请结合《Java平台上的藏式打骰子游戏设计与实现》一文详细说明。
时间: 2024-12-03 19:36:56 浏览: 19
在将传统文化与现代技术结合的过程中,开发一款具有藏族特色的打骰子电子游戏是一项兼具挑战与意义的任务。首先,需要理解藏式打骰子游戏的规则和文化背景,这是将游戏设计与藏族文化元素相结合的基础。《Java平台上的藏式打骰子游戏设计与实现》一文详细介绍了整个项目的开发过程,包括需求分析、设计、编码以及测试等多个阶段,为开发者提供了宝贵的参考。
参考资源链接:[Java平台上的藏式打骰子游戏设计与实现](https://wenku.csdn.net/doc/7t3t6dvw9v?spm=1055.2569.3001.10343)
使用Java语言进行游戏开发,可以利用其强大的跨平台能力,确保游戏在多种操作系统上都能运行。同时,Java的对象导向特性使得代码更加模块化,易于管理和维护。Eclipse作为开发工具,提供了便捷的代码编辑、调试和项目管理功能,可以加速开发流程。
具体到开发步骤,首先应该设计游戏的基本逻辑和界面布局。例如,需要设计棋盘、骰子以及玩家的交互方式。对于界面设计,可以采用Swing或JavaFX等图形用户界面库,实现美观且具有藏族特色的用户界面。在实现吃子、走子和叠子等益智规则时,需要编写相应的算法逻辑。
在编程实现方面,可以通过创建继承自JFrame的主窗口类来构建游戏界面,使用JButton来实现骰子按钮,并利用事件监听来响应用户的点击事件。对于骰子的随机数生成,可以使用java.util.Random类或Math.random()方法来实现。游戏规则的逻辑判断需要编写成函数或方法,以便在游戏的不同阶段调用。
为了增强游戏体验,可以集成藏族音乐和背景图片,利用多媒体处理技术来提升游戏的文化氛围。最后,需要对游戏进行充分的测试,包括功能测试、性能测试和用户体验测试,确保游戏的稳定性和流畅性。
结合《Java平台上的藏式打骰子游戏设计与实现》一文,开发者不仅可以学习到如何设计和编码,还能够了解到项目中可能遇到的问题及其解决策略,这对完成一个高质量的藏式打骰子游戏至关重要。
参考资源链接:[Java平台上的藏式打骰子游戏设计与实现](https://wenku.csdn.net/doc/7t3t6dvw9v?spm=1055.2569.3001.10343)
阅读全文